Milestones in Men's Fashion That Paved the Way for Streetwear

Streetwear's journey in men's fashion is marked by key milestones. Baggy jeans of the 1990s jumpstarted a casual trend. Hip-hop artists set the wheel in motion with their iconic style. Early 2000s skate culture added unique graphics and sneakers. Luxury brands marrying streetwear caused a seismic shift. Collabs between high fashion and street labels became common. Social media blew up streetwear's popularity globally. Techwear introduced a new edge with performance fabrics. Today, streetwear's evolution continues as a major force in men's fashion.

The Significance of Oversized Fits: Hoodies and Tees

Oversized fits have become iconic in men's streetwear. It's about comfort and style. Both hoodies and tees often come in baggy sizes. This trend started in the hip-hop scene. Now, it's popular across various cultures in the US. These large fits allow for easy movement. They also give a relaxed, carefree vibe. When it comes to tees, graphic designs are a hit. They often carry bold statements or art. Oversized hoodies serve as both statement pieces and everyday wear. They can be plain or feature logos and patterns. Layering them is common in streetwear looks too. Remember, with oversized fits, balance is key. Pair them with slimmer pants to keep a structured look.

The Role of Footwear: Sneaker Culture and Men's Shoes

In the realm of men's streetwear, footwear holds a status that goes beyond mere function. Sneakers, in particular, have become cultural icons, representing self-expression and identity. The United States has seen a surge in sneaker culture, with collaborations between high-end designers and classic sneaker brands becoming commonplace. This union has redefined men's shoes as a key element of streetwear. Limited-edition releases and exclusive drops keep enthusiasts on their toes, literally and figuratively. Beyond sneakers, other forms of men's footwear, such as boots or slip-ons, are also gaining traction in streetwear, offering both comfort and style. Embracing these trends, men are now investing in shoes that seal their street-inspired ensembles.

The Revolution of Men's Suits and Shorts in Streetwear

The men's streetwear scene is seeing a major shake-up in its approach to suits and shorts. Traditional formal wear no longer stands apart from the casual, street-savvy aesthetic. Suits are being reimagined with relaxed fits, unusual materials, and bold patterns, blending seamlessly with streetwear's ethos. Meanwhile, shorts are not just for summer anymore. They come in a variety of lengths and styles, often paired with high-top sneakers or boots for an all-year-round urban look. The revolution is all about breaking rules and mixing formal with casual in unexpected ways.
